Common Hallway Lighting Installation Jobs
Hallway Lighting Installation - Enhances visibility and safety in hallways and corridors.
Accent Lighting - Adds style and highlights architectural features or artwork.
Recessed Lighting - Provides a clean, modern look with evenly distributed illumination.
Motion Sensor Lights - Improves convenience and energy efficiency in high-traffic areas.
Pendant or Chandeliers - Creates a focal point and adds decorative appeal to entryways.
Smart Lighting Systems - Offers customizable control and automation for hallway lighting.
Hallway Lighting Installation Questions
What are common types of hallway lighting options? Common options include recessed lights, wall sconces, and LED strip lighting to enhance visibility and style.
How does hallway lighting improve safety? Proper lighting reduces shadows and dark spots, making hallways safer to navigate at all times.
Can hallway lighting be installed in existing spaces? Yes, many lighting solutions can be added or upgraded in existing hallways without major renovations.
What should property owners consider when choosing hallway lighting? Consider the brightness level, fixture style, and energy efficiency to match the hallway’s function and design.
